Senate Bill 285 of 2021

Sponsors

Categories

Elections: absent voters; Elections: voters; Elections: election officials
Elections: absent voters; identification for election purposes to obtain an absent voter ballot; require, and require a provisional ballot be issued to absent voters without identification for election purpose. Amends secs. 759, 759a, 759b & 761 of 1954 PA 116 (MCL 168.759 et seq.).

History

(House actions in lowercase, Senate actions in UPPERCASE)
Note: A page number of 0 indicates that the page number is coming soon
Date Journal Action
3/24/2021 SJ 27 Pg. 413 INTRODUCED BY SENATOR LANA THEIS
3/24/2021 SJ 27 Pg. 413 REFERRED TO COMMITTEE ON ELECTIONS
6/03/2021 SJ 51 Pg. 899 REPORTED FAVORABLY WITH SUBSTITUTE (S-1)
6/03/2021 SJ 51 Pg. 899 COMMITTEE RECOMMENDED IMMEDIATE EFFECT
6/03/2021 SJ 51 Pg. 899 REFERRED TO COMMITTEE OF THE WHOLE WITH SUBSTITUTE (S-1)
6/16/2021 SJ 56 Pg. 974 REPORTED BY COMMITTEE OF THE WHOLE FAVORABLY WITH SUBSTITUTE (S-1)
6/16/2021 SJ 56 Pg. 974 SUBSTITUTE (S-1) CONCURRED IN
6/16/2021 SJ 56 Pg. 974 PLACED ON ORDER OF THIRD READING WITH SUBSTITUTE (S-1)
6/16/2021 SJ 56 Pg. 976 RULES SUSPENDED
6/16/2021 SJ 56 Pg. 976 PLACED ON IMMEDIATE PASSAGE
6/16/2021 SJ 56 Pg. 978 PASSED ROLL CALL # 274 YEAS 19 NAYS 16 EXCUSED 1 NOT VOTING 0
6/16/2021 HJ 57 Pg. 1118 received on 06/16/2021
6/16/2021 HJ 57 Pg. 1120 read a first time
6/16/2021 HJ 57 Pg. 1120 referred to Committee on Elections and Ethics
